Rackmount Servers: A Comprehensive Guide to Choosing the Right One for Your Business

by ERacks System eRacks Open Source Systems

Rackmount servers have become a critical component of modern data centers and businesses of all sizes. They are designed to optimize space and provide reliable performance, making them a popular choice for businesses looking to upgrade their IT infrastructure. In this comprehensive guide, we will explore the key considerations to help you choose the right rack mount server for your business.

First and foremost, it's important to understand the difference between rackmount servers and traditional tower servers. Rackmount servers are designed to be mounted in a server rack, which is a standardized framework used to organize and store IT equipment. This design allows you to maximize your available space while providing efficient cooling and easy accessibility. In contrast, tower servers take up valuable floor space and can be more difficult to maintain.

When choosing a rackmount server, it's essential to consider your business's specific requirements. For example, the amount of storage and processing power you need will depend on the size of your organization and the applications you're running. If you're storing large amounts of data, you may require a server with multiple hard drives. Similarly, if you're running high-performance applications, you'll need a server with a powerful processor and ample memory.

Another key consideration is the type of rackmount server you require. There are two main types: blade servers and rackmount servers. Blade servers are slim and compact, making them ideal for businesses with limited space. They are also highly scalable and can be easily upgraded to meet growing business needs.

On the other hand, traditional rackmount servers are larger and typically offer more storage and processing power.

Finally, it's important to consider the vendor and support options available for the rackmount server you choose. Look for a vendor that offers comprehensive support, including 24/7 technical assistance, firmware upgrades, and hardware replacement. It's also essential to consider the warranty and maintenance options offered by the vendor to ensure that you receive the support you need to keep your IT infrastructure running smoothly.
